We stayed at A Stone's Throw for the weekend of my high school reunion. I grew up in the Livingston area, and, in fact, attended junior high on the site where the B & B is located. I was curious and excited about staying there for that, and many other reasons. It exceeded all my expectations!

If you are looking for casual, Western luxury and hospitality, this is your place. Mick and Donald have gone out of their way to carefully create an atmosphere of relaxed, warm comfort, with special touches throughout the home. Large, inviting common spaces invite you to curl up with a book, or contemplate life in the West.

The guest rooms follow suit with top-class comfort. We stayed in the "Peak" guest room, which was more than enough space for two, and the most comfortable bed in the world! Dual-head shower in the huge bathroom. Lockers from the old school's old gym as your bedside table. Quiet relaxation, and a view of Livingston Peak.

And the food? Oh, the food..... Mick asked us our preference for Savory or Sweet, and we tried both on our visit. True gourmet breakfast, absolutely stunning! It kept us fed for the rest of the day :-)

Friendly resident dog Una greets guests, and hangs out in the downstairs common area for pets and cuddles. She knows where she can and cannot go in the house, and is a welcome part of the whole home.

The B & B is conveniently located only a couple of blocks from downtown Livingston, which has plenty of restaurants and watering holes (as well as galleries) to explore. And, it's close to the iconic railroad tracks, an important part of LIvingston's history. You will hear the trains in the distance.

All in all, if you want to be pampered in true Western comfort, look no further than A Stone's Throw. I now have to figure out how I'm going to tell my resident family that I don't want to stay with them - I want to stay at Mick and Donald's B & B! :-)
